Pro Bowl Player Offers Significant Health Update

The Los Angeles Chargers struggled with injuries last season, which limited the playing time of many key players. One standout player who missed most of the season was Pro Bowl edge rusher Joey Bosa. However, as of June, Bosa is feeling healthy and optimistic about the upcoming season.

In a recent interview, Bosa expressed his gratitude for feeling better at 28 years old than he did in previous years. He is eager to prove himself as one of the league’s top edge rushers when he is in good health, showcasing his exceptional skills.

Despite his recent setbacks, the Chargers have faith in Bosa’s abilities, evident in their decision to restructure his contract. The team prioritized retaining Bosa over offensive stars like Keenan Allen and Mike Williams, demonstrating their belief in his impact on the team.

With a new defensive coordinator, head coach, and additions to the roster, Bosa has the opportunity for a fresh start and renewed success. If he can stay healthy, Bosa has the potential to make a significant impact on the Chargers’ defense in the upcoming season.
